Nobody can predict the future but if we think that Amazon has a ~15 billion USD volume/ year, I find it more than reasonable to approximate with that.
so I would guess that ~15 million BTC equals 15 bilion USD so 1 BTC equals 1000 USD.

This assuming that all the BTCs will be in continous trading and not kept somewhere. If we consider only half of the coins will be used for trading, it means 1 BTC ~ 2000 USD.

Logically speaking, I find it very likely 1-2 year(s) from now, BTC to have this value.

Nobody though can calculate the mass hysteria of investors having their funds chased for (to be read as being robbed) as in Cyprus example.

I think any event threatening the security of financial markets will lead to a BTC price increase.

To sum up, it is impossible to predict a price, but 2 years from now, 2000USD/BTC i find it very very likely.
